Above West Lake, mist and rain blurred the view, and the Broken Bridge lay quietly across the water, as if whispering tales of a thousand years. Xu Xuan held an oil-paper umbrella and slowly stepped onto the bridge. His gaze was tinged with melancholy, his thoughts drifting back to the times he had spent with Xiaobai and Xiaoqing. These days, he had been cultivating in East Sea Bay, yet he could never forget those two women.

Suddenly, a gentle breeze swept by. Xu Xuan lifted his eyes to see two familiar figures appearing at the far end of the Broken Bridge.

Xiaobai still wore her white robes, ethereal like a fairy descending to earth, her features refined and graceful, her eyes filled with warmth and surprise. Xiaoqing donned a vibrant green outfit, lively and playful, her eyes sparkling brightly.

“Xu Xuan!” Xiaobai called softly, her voice trembling with restrained excitement.

Xu Xuan quickened his pace, joy lighting his eyes. “Xiaobai, Xiaoqing—it really is you!”

Xiaoqing giggled. “Xu Xuan, at last we meet again.”

Xiaobai stepped forward, scrutinizing him carefully. “Xu Xuan, you look… more composed now.”

Xu Xuan smiled gently. “These days of cultivation have brought many trials and much growth.”

Curious, Xiaoqing asked, “Xu Xuan, what level have you reached in your cultivation?”

“I’m still at the Qi Refining stage,” Xu Xuan replied, “but I’m steadily working to improve.”

Xiaobai nodded thoughtfully. “Qi Refining is the foundation; one must not rush the process.”

The three stood on the Broken Bridge as the raindrops fell like a fine curtain of pearls around them. Xu Xuan gazed at Xiaobai and Xiaoqing, his heart heavy with emotion. “I often think of the days we shared—those memories flow within me like the waters of West Lake.”

Xiaoqing patted Xu Xuan’s shoulder playfully. “You really are sentimental, aren’t you?”

Xiaobai cast a teasing glance at Xiaoqing. “Stop teasing Xu Xuan.”

Xu Xuan asked, “Xiaobai, Xiaoqing, how have you both been these days?”

Xiaobai answered, “We have been cultivating as well, traveling to many places. There is so much wonder in this world, but also great danger.”

Xiaoqing added, “Yes, once we encountered a fierce demon that nearly trapped us. But Sister Xiaobai’s magic drove it away.”

Xu Xuan’s heart tightened. “Did you get hurt?”

Xiaobai shook her head. “No, Xu Xuan. Don’t worry. We have our own strengths.”

At that moment, ripples spread across the lake beneath the bridge.

Looking at the water, Xu Xuan suddenly said, “Xiaobai, Xiaoqing, I hope we can travel together in the future, watching out for one another. I know my power isn’t strong enough yet, but I will do my best to protect you.”

Xiaoqing’s eyes sparkled. “Yes, yes! That way, we can be like before.”

Xiaobai looked at Xu Xuan, her eyes touched with emotion. “We understand your feelings, Xu Xuan. But the world is ever-changing—we must all be cautious.”

The rain gradually ceased, and sunlight filtered through the clouds, casting its glow upon the Broken Bridge.

Xu Xuan, Xiaobai, and Xiaoqing stood together, their shadows stretched long in the light, as if heralding the new journey they were about to embark upon.

They all knew hardships and dangers lay ahead, but as long as the three of them stood united, they would have the courage to face whatever the world might bring.
